We provide IT Staff Augmentation Services!

Senior .net Developer Resume

Weston, FL

SUMMARY:

  • 7+ Years of experience in designing, developing, and maintaining web and client/server applications using Microsoft Technologies.
  • Expertise in all the phases of Software Development Life Cycle (SDLC) including requirements, analysis, design, implementation, integration and testing, deployment and maintenance.
  • Expertise in .NET framework with great proficiency in creating applications using Web Forms, ASP.NET, C#/VB.NET, ASP.NET MVC, Cascading Style Sheets (CSS), JavaScript, IIS (Versions), SQL Server /2008, and Visual Studio.NET, Web Service, WCF.
  • Expertise in working with Web Server Controls, HTML Controls, User Controls, Custom Controls using C# and VB.NET.
  • U sed an array in a program in - order to declare a variable to reference the array.
  • Experience in advanced JavaScript/UI frameworks like AngularJS, Bootstrap/UI, ReactJS, and Charting Libraries.
  • Experience in writing complex user defined Functions, Stored Procedures, Views, Triggers, and cursors using MS SQL Server.
  • Used the WCF/Web Services to accessing data from a database on a back-end server and displaying it in user interface .
  • Experience in relational database design, data extraction, data transformation and loading from large and complex data sources using MS SQLServer 2008/2005/2000 ).
  • Experience with development of applications using MVCframework, Bootstrap, MVVM and WCF.
  • Hands on experience in Distributed Technologies like Web Services.
  • Planning /Development, Test procedures and analyzing the test results, Unit & Integration Testing with N unit.

TECHNICAL SKILLS:

Programming Languages: Visual C#, Visual Basic

Web Technologies: ASP.NET MVC, HTML, CSS, AJAX, Web Services, WCF

Scripting Languages: JavaScript, JQuery, Angular JS

Markup Languages: HTML, DHTML, XML, XAML

. NET Technologies: . NET Framework (1.1/2.0, 3.5, 4.0/4.5), Web Services

Software Engineering: SDLC, UML, Agile Programming (Scrum, Kan-ban)

Database Development: SQL Server, SSRS, Mongo DB

RAD/IDE: Visual Studio 2003/2005/2008/2010/2013 , Visual Basic 6.0, Jet Brains Rider

Version Control: Visual SourceSafe, Team Foundation Server (TFS), GIT Hub

Modeling and Testing Tools: Microsoft Visio 2003, NUnit

PROFESSIONAL EXPERIENCE:

Senior .Net Developer

Confidential, Weston, FL

Responsibilities:

  • Involved in understanding user requirements, designing and developing web application and backend applications.
  • Heavily followed Agile Kanban methodologies. Followed Event Driven Design patterns.
  • Coordinate with Architect & Tech Leads on development techniques and standards.
  • Maintaining the legacy application and migrating the customers from Oracle Db instance.
  • Developed web applications using JavaScript, JQuery, AngularJS using the ASP.NET.
  • Worked on creating web Services using ASP.NET Web API and C#.
  • Performed Unit, Integration testing using N-Unit framework (Used Fake-It-Easy for mocking purposes).
  • Implemented AngularJS Controllers to maintain each view data. Implemented Angular Service calls using Angular Factory.
  • Implemented Rabbit MQ for Windows with Direct Exchanges, with Consumers and Producers for data integration with Services.
  • Used Dependency Injection, to inject dependent objects into the method when it was called.
  • Created tables and indexes and wrote Stored Procedures, Functions and Triggers in SQL Server
  • Designed large numbers of Web Forms, Custom Controls and User Controls for UI and Dynamic Web Parts for personalized content which allows Change, Edit, Move the content on pages as per user’s own choice.
  • Responsible for designing the web pages Using ASP.NET Master Pages, Web Forms, JQuery, User Controls, Data Grid Controls, Form Validation controls, Custom controls and CSS.
  • Created Service Layer using C#. Used Generics, Lambda Expressions, Extension Methods, LINQ to SQL, LINQ to Objects & Implemented LINQ for querying, sorting, filtering the complex objects.
  • Developing the view models and controller actions method to fetch the data from the back-end Rest services and send it as JSON objects to the views.
  • Implemented & Used Microsoft Entity Framework Code first approach for the Data Access Layer.
  • Design and implement Restful API layer along with calls to consume an API layer.
  • Used C#, Visual Studio 2015 Event Driven design & Test Driven Design pattern. Experience with AJAX, JavaScript, HTML, JQuery, Enterprise Library and JSON, SQL Server.
  • Designed and developed various abstract classes, interfaces, classes to construct the business logic using C#.
  • Used JavaScript to perform validations and catch the events on client's browser.
  • Responsible to create new Web-Api endpoints using ASP.Net with C#.
  • Highly Participated in Code-Reviews for better coding practices.
  • Utilized Git Hub (Git Bash & Git Kraken) for the purpose of version Control and source code maintenance needs.
  • Familiar with TeamCity.
  • Familiar with MongoDB (Used Studio-3T for Querying).
  • Familiar and also Used Rabbit-MQ for Messaging and Exchange queue.
  • Environment:Visual Studio 2015, JetBrains-Rider, SQL Server, C#, ASP.NET 4.5, MongoDB, Rabbit MQ, HTML, Web-Forms, JavaScript, JQuery, AngularJS, Entity Framework, GIT (Git-Bash & Git-Kraken).

Senior .Net Developer

Confidential, PA

Responsibilities:

  • Involved in understanding user requirements, designing and developing web application and backend applications.
  • Coordinate with IT Manager / .NET Architect on development techniques and standards.
  • Developed web applications using HTML, CSS, JavaScript, JQuery, AngularJS, and IISusing the ASP.NET MVC.
  • Setting up AngularJS framework for UI development. Developed views with HTML, CSS, JQuery, JSON, and Java Script.
  • Created LINQ enabled database layer using API such as LINQ to SQL and Entity Framework
  • Used Windows Communication Foundation (WCF) Service for Business Logic Layer for Service Oriented Architecture.
  • Used ASP.NET Master Pages, JQuery, utilizing Server Controls, User Controls, Data Grid Controls, Form Validation controls, Custom controls and CSS.
  • Created Service Layer using C# and WCF &Implemented HTTP protocol to secure the information between WCF Service and Client. Used Generics, Lambda Expressions, Extension Methods, LINQ to SQL, LINQ to Objects
  • Implemented LINQ for querying, sorting, filtering the complex objects.
  • Developed the website in MVC 4.0 using Razor engine.Implemented AngularJS Controllers to maintain each view data
  • Implemented the DAL using the Entity Framework 4 Code-First paradigm &Customize entity relationships and mappings.
  • Developed code to validate the user credentials for authenticating user to access the WCF service.
  • Used Angular UI -bootstrap and CSS 3, JavaScript, JQuery for various client side operations
  • Implemented HTML Server Controls, ASP Server Controls along with Validation Controls
  • Designed and developed various abstract classes, interfaces, classes to construct the business logic using C#.
  • Used JavaScript to perform validations and catch the events on client's browser.
  • Responsible to create new web services using ASP.Net with C# . Used WCF services to access data from data store
  • Support/modify the exiting web services as per user requirements.
  • Used JQuery and AJAX to make asynchronous calls to the Controllers to validate business logic and load partial views in MVC.
  • Created WCF Services responsible for communicating and providing real time data from integrated server to Client Application.
  • Performed unit testing using NUnit and did code reviews.
  • Utilized Team Foundation Server TFS for the purpose of version Control and source code maintenance needs.

Environment: Visual Studio 2015, C#, ASP.NET MVC, WCF, SQL Server, JavaScript, JQuery,Data Tables, AngularJS, Ajax, Boot Strap, Entity Framework , TFS.

Senior .Net Developer

Confidential, OK

Responsibilities:

  • Mostly responsible for backend development of new features using C#, ASP.NET MVC and Web API.
  • Involved in understanding user requirements, designing and developing web application and back end applications.
  • Developed .NET C# object oriented code to support ASP.Net applications.
  • Designed REST APIs that allow sophisticated, effective and low cost application integration
  • Extensively used LINQ and ORM tools like Entity Framework to exchange data between web applications and database objects
  • Create Databaseon SQL AZURE. Generate reports and extracts from Database based on the requirement.
  • Coordinate with IT Manager / .NET Architect on development techniques and standards.
  • Built dynamically generated dropdown lists using Ajax, JQuery.
  • Used JQuery and AJAX to make asynchronous calls to the Controllers to validate business logic and load partial views in MVC.
  • Used AngularJS as the development framework to build a single-page application.
  • Web application development for backend system using AngularJS and Node.js with cutting edge HTML5 and CSS3 techniques
  • Wrote AngularJS controllers, views and services for new website features.
  • Web application development for backend system using AngularJS and Node.js with cutting edge HTML5 and CSS3 techniques.
  • Developed a prototype from scratch using ASP.NET MVC 3 and Entity Framework 4.3 for referring patients to pharmacies within a network.
  • Used ADO.NET objects such as Dataset and Data Adapter, for consistent access to Oracle.
  • Used ADO.NET extensively to interact with SQL Server and Oracle Writing Stored procedures for SQL Server and Oracle. Managing the SQL server databases.
  • Developed facilities for stripping long error messages from minified JavaScript code for AngularJS.
  • Designed and implemented a number of support tools using ASP.NET MVC, WEB API, JavaScript
  • Applied J-Query scripts for basic animation and end user screen customization purposes.
  • Implemented HTML Server Controls, ASP Server Controls along with Validation Controls.
  • Developed interactive web pages using JavaScript, Master Pages, Themes, CSS, Grid View controls in ASP.Net.
  • Designed and developed stored procedures and triggers for SQL Server & Oracle database.
  • Worked on highly advanced and user interface design and development using HTML5 and CSS3.
  • Maintain expert knowledge of client side technologies including HTML, JavaScript, CSS, and AJAX.
  • Wrote business logic code in C# code behind files to read data from database stored procedures.
  • Develop special .NET projects in Visual Studio to support business operations.
  • Maintained advanced ability to produce reports in SQL Reporting Services using Visual Studio.

Environment: Visual Studio 2012, C#, ASP.NET, MVC,WEB API, REST,SQL Server, Oracle10g, JavaScript, JQuery,AngularJS, Ajax, Boot Strap, TFS, Smart sheet.

Senior .Net Developer

Confidential, FL

Responsibilities:

  • Involved in analysis of application functionality and its redesign.
  • Developed .NET C# object oriented code to support ASP.Net applications.
  • Coordinate with IT Manager / .NET Architect on development techniques and standards.
  • Creation of form and its controls at runtime based on the DB values using AJAX, C# and ASP.NET.
  • Developed interactive web pages using JavaScript, Master Pages, Themes, CSS, Tree view and Grid View controls in ASP.Net.
  • Utilized ADO.NET technology extensively for data retrieving, querying, storage and manipulation using LINQ. Statements, views, User Defined Functions, Stored Procedures for inserting/updating/Deleting the data into the relational tables.
  • Used Generics, Lambda Expressions, Extension Methods, LINQ to SQL, LINQ to Objects
  • Implemented LINQ for querying, sorting, filtering the complex objects.
  • Built dynamically generated dropdown lists using Ajax, JQuery.
  • Designing and Developing Windows forms in C#.
  • Used JQuery and AJAX to make asynchronous calls to the Controllers to validate business logic and load partial views in MVC.
  • Implemented WPF in creating custom controls, 3D graphics.
  • Applied J-Query scripts for basic animation and end user screen customization purposes.
  • Implemented HTML Server Controls, ASP Server Controls along with Validation Controls.
  • Designed and developed WCF services used to communicate data to client databases and authenticate data.
  • Used JQuery and AJAX to make asynchronous calls to the Controllers to validate business logic and load partial views in MVC.
  • Tested all application controllers extensively with angular built-in testing facilities.
  • Programmed Data Access Layer using ADO.NET, which involved in accessing data from the Database using Connected Architecture, which requires the strong OOPS, concepts.
  • Implemented HTML Server Controls, ASP Server Controls along with Validation Controls.
  • Designed and developed stored procedures and triggers for SQL Server 2008 database.
  • Used JQuery and AJAX to make asynchronous calls to the Controllers to validate business logic and load partial views in MVC.
  • Wrote AngularJS controllers, views and services for new website features.
  • Used WPF in creating different animated scenes using the combination of transforms, animation controls
  • Created rich and interactive UI using WPF.
  • Web application development for backend system using AngularJS and Node.js with cutting edge HTML5 and CSS3 techniques
  • Maintain expert knowledge of client side technologies including HTML, JavaScript, CSS, and Ajax.
  • Developed and consumed WCF services to retrieve the product information at different parts of the application.
  • Used WPF and WCF to communicate between DAL and other business components.
  • Performed unit testing using NUnit and did code reviews.
  • Implemented HTML Server Controls, ASP Server Controls along with Validation Controls.

Environment: Visual Studio 2012, C#, ASP.NET, ADO.NET, MVC,PL/SQL, TFS, SQL Server 2008, WPF, Active reports, JavaScript, AngularJS, AJAX, JQuery.

.Net Developer

Confidential, Urbandale, IA

Responsibilities:

  • Maintain existing NFM Website application in terms of bug fixing, code review, enhancing the functionalities.
  • Wrote high quality Code in VB.NET & ASP.NET for the complex part / modules of the project.
  • Created web custom controls and web user controls where necessary.
  • Used Datasets, Data Reader and SQLData Adapter for interacting with Database.
  • Created and consumed Web Services using C#, ADO.NET and SQL Server.
  • Requirement analysis, impact analysis and Design the code fixes.
  • Implemented .Net framework 4.0, N-tier architecture and Object Oriented Methodologies for application development.
  • Used Generics, Lambda Expressions, Extension Methods, LINQ to SQL, LINQ to Objects
  • Implemented LINQ for querying, sorting, filtering the complex objects.
  • Developed various backend application programs, such as Views, Functions, Triggers, Procedures and Packages using SQL and PL/SQL language for the top management for decision making.
  • Involved in PL/SQL code review and modification for the development of new requirements.
  • Worked on various backend Procedures and Functions using PL/SQL
  • Developed dynamic ASPX web pages for Application using ASP.NET, C#.NET, XML, XSL/XSLT/XPath, HTML, JavaScript and AJAX including jQuery library.
  • Responsible for resolving the problem logs and bugs in the application.
  • Created and maintained database table, user logins, views, indexes, and constraints to implement business rules and also created Triggers to enforce data and referential integrity.
  • Utilized ADO.NET technology extensively for data retrieving, querying, storage and manipulation using LINQ. Statements, views, User Defined Functions, Stored Procedures for inserting/updating/Deleting the data into the relational tables.
  • Written client side validation scripts in JavaScript language and extensively used JQuery.
  • Wrote PL/SQL Database triggers to implement the business rules in the application.
  • Coded PL-SQL packages and procedures to perform data loading, error handling and logging.
  • Involve in designing and developing the GUI for the user interface with various controls.
  • Used HTML and Cascading Style Sheets (CSS) to attain uniformity of all web pages.
  • Worked together with Business Analyst to get the business requirements and finished the tasks as per the requirements.
  • Had different branches in SVN for each of the developers so that the merge would be easy after working individually. Merged to dev. environment after successful testing by QA.

Environment: .Net Framework 4.0, VisualStudio2012, Scrum Methodology, ASP.NET 4.5, SVN, VB.NET, ASP.NET, PL/SQL, SQL Server 2012, JQuery, JavaScript, HTML, CSS, IIS 7.0, Web Services.

.Net Developer

Confidential, Los Angeles, CA

Responsibilities:

  • Involved in understanding user requirements, designing and developing web application and back end applications.
  • Interacted with business analysts, end-users and worked on the application specifications to develop detailed functional, technical design, and test specifications that fully satisfies business requirements.
  • Design web application wireframe as per business requirement
  • Designed and develop user interface for public web application and intranet application using Visual Studio 2010, ASP.NET, C #, .NET 3.5, and VB.NET, AJAX, XML and CSS with object oriented programming techniques. Used various features of C# and .Net (e.g. reflections, generics, partial classes, LINQ etc.).
  • Developer presentation layer of both public and intranet application
  • Build technical architecture of application and document design in high level and low-level design document.
  • Develop application infrastructure component like logging, exception handling, data access, and caching and cryptographic application block.
  • Demonstrating the architectural implementation through code and design
  • Design application architecture, design and code reviews
  • Develop systems using .NET components and implemented the Data Access layers using ADO.NET. Used ADO.NET objects such as data reader, data adapter and dataset for consistent access of the data from data layer.
  • Develop stored procedures, functions, triggers using Oracle for fetching data and binding &authorization and card details database

Environment: Visual Studio.Net 2010, C# .NET 3.5, ASP.NET, Oracle, LINQ, XML, SQL Server 2008, TFS, CSS, JavaScript, JQuery, VB.NET, NUnit

Hire Now